Fatu Feu'u : On Life & Art
Paperback Edition: 1
In this book, Fatu shares
his story, from wilful Samoan-village boy, to New Zealand factory-worker immigrant, to leader in his home communities and the global art world.
His thoughts on art and life are woven into an inspiring tale that helps us understand not only what drives this artist, but what’s behind his art - how the bright colours, the frangipani, ta-tatau and siapo designs create a narrative of his past, present and future.
